I-ASTM A335 / ASME SA335iyincazelo ejwayelekile yamapayipi ensimbi e-ferritic alloy angenamthungo ahloselwe isevisi yokucindezela okuphezulu okushisa okuphezulu. Njengebanga eliyinhloko ochungechungeni lwe-9Cr-1Mo, i-P9 ifinyelela ukuthuthukiswa kokusebenza okuphindwe kathathu ekumelaneni nokushisa, ukumelana nokugqwala kanye nokumelana nokuqhekeka ngokulinganisa okunembile kwe-chromium kanye ne-molybdenum.
Ukwakheka Kwamakhemikhali Ayinhloko kanye Nemisebenzi
| I-Alloying Element | Ububanzi Bokuqukethwe | Umsebenzi Wokusebenza |
|---|---|---|
| I-Chromium (Cr) | 8.0% – 10.0% | Yakha ungqimba oluqinile, oluziphilisayo lwe-chromium oxide ebusweni bepayipi, oluthuthukisa kakhulu ukumelana nokugqwala kwe-oxidation ekushiseni okuphezulu kanye nokumelana nokugqwala kwe-sulfide, olufanelekelauwoyela omuncu kanye nemithombo yegesi |
| I-Molybdenum (Mo) | 0.90% – 1.10% | Kuthuthukisa amandla okushisa okuphezulu kanye nokumelana nokukhukhuleka ngokuqinisa isixazululo esiqinile, kuvimbela ukuguquguquka kwamapayipi kanye nokwehluleka ngaphansi kokushisa okuphezulu kwesikhathi eside kanye nengcindezi |
Izakhiwo Eziyinhloko Zemishini
- Amandla amancane okudonsa:415 MPa
- Amandla amancane okukhiqiza:205 MPa
- Izinga lokushisa eliphezulu eliqhubekayo:≤ 650°C
- Ukuthobela imithetho yezinto ezibonakalayo: KuhlangabezanaI-NACE MR0175izidingo zokumelana nokuqhekeka kokucindezeleka kwe-sulfide, ezifanele izindawo ezimuncu kawoyela negesi
Uma kuqhathaniswa nensimbi yekhabhoni evamile, ipayipi le-P9 alloy linikeza impilo ende yokuqhekeka kwe-creep ebangeni lama-500–600°C, okwenza kube yinto ekhethwayo yamayunithi okuhlanza okushisa okuphezulu kanye namapayipi omusi acindezelwe kakhulu.

2. Amayunithi Okucubungula Nokucwenga Amakhemikhali
Kumayunithi ayinhloko ezindawo zokuhlanza ze-SOCAR ezifana nokuqhekeka kwe-catalytic, i-hydrodesulfurization kanye nama-heater okulungisa, amapayipi e-P9 alloy asetshenziswa kabanzi ku:
- Amashubhu esithando kanye nemigqa yokudlulisa eshisa kakhulu
- Amapayipi okungena nawokuphuma kwama-hydrogenation reactors
- Amapayipi aphakathi nendawo anomuncu okushisa okuphezulu kumayunithi okususa i-sulfurization
Ukumelana kwayo okuhle kakhulu nokuhlasela kwe-hydrogen kanye nokumelana nokugqwala kwe-sulfide kunganciphisa kakhulu ukuvalwa kwesitshalo kanye nemvamisa yokugcinwa.

Iziqondiso Zokwakha Nokushisela Esakhiweni
I-A335 P9 iyinsimbi ye-ferritic alloy ene-chromium ephezulu enokuthambekela okuqinile kokuqina komoya. Ukushisela nokwakha endaweni kufanele kulandele izidingo ezikhethekile zenqubo ukuze kugwenywe ukuqhekeka okubandayo kuma-weld:
- Ukushisa ngaphambi kokushisela: Shisa izinhlangothi zombili zomsele ngaphambi kokushisela, izinga lokushisa lokushisa elingaphansi kuka-200°C; izinga lokushisa lokushisa eliphakeme linconywa kumapayipi anodonga olusindayo.
- Ukwelashwa kokushisa ngemva kokushiswa (PWHT): Yenza ukufudumeza ngemva kokushisela ngokushesha ngemva kokushisela ukuze ususe ukucindezeleka kokushisela okusele futhi ubuyisele ukuqina kwendawo ethinteke ukushisa kokushisela, uqinisekise ukuthi ukusebenza kwamalunga kufana nensimbi eyisisekelo.
- Izinto ezisetshenziswayo ezifanayo: Sebenzisa izinto ezisetshenziswayo zokushisela ezifanela izinga elifanayo ukuqinisekisa ukuthi ukwakheka kwe-weld alloy kanye nokumelana nokugqwala kuhambisana nesisekelo sensimbi.
